Offspring

Webster's Dictionary

(1):

(n.sing. & pl.) That which is produced; a child or children; a descendant or descendants, however remote from the stock.

(2):

(n.sing. & pl.) Origin; lineage; family.

(3):

(n.sing. & pl.) The act of production; generation.
